Ploopy BTU Print File

I did alter it a bit, maybe enough to warrant a remix version. I split the model from two to three pieces. I found the distance between the sensor and ball to be very sensitive and a mm would take it from being great to being unusable. Since I used a Kensington ball and not a pool ball, having a third section allowed me to dial in that distance without having to reprint the entire top. It also removed an overhand that would have otherwise needed printing supports.

That's a Ploopy nano pcb in a printed BTU base. I needed something more symmetrical than the original Ploopy one. I also used a 55mm trackball Kensington because I liked the size better.
